https://github.com/netobserv/netobserv-catalog
https://github.com/netobserv/netobserv-catalog
Last synced: 7 months ago
JSON representation
- Host: GitHub
- URL: https://github.com/netobserv/netobserv-catalog
- Owner: netobserv
- License: apache-2.0
- Created: 2025-03-05T13:55:14.000Z (over 1 year ago)
- Default Branch: main
- Last Pushed: 2025-11-04T14:22:39.000Z (7 months ago)
- Last Synced: 2025-11-04T16:11:46.980Z (7 months ago)
- Language: Makefile
- Size: 13.4 MB
- Stars: 1
- Watchers: 1
- Forks: 3
- Open Issues: 2
-
Metadata Files:
- Readme: README.md
- License: LICENSE.md
Awesome Lists containing this project
README
# Netobserv Catalog
This repository build the Netobserv OLM catalog used to release new version of Openshift Network Observability Operator.
Some of the comands below require an access to `registry.redhat.io`. Make sure you have it (e.g. by running `export REGISTRY_AUTH_FILE=/path/to/secret.json` first).
To generate all catalogs from template:
```bash
make generate
```
To build the catalog with released version:
```bash
podman build -t catalog .
```
To use upstream opm:
```bash
podman build -t catalog -f upstream.Dockerfile .
```
To use a different generated catalog:
```bash
podman build --build-arg INDEX_FILE=./auto-generated/.yaml -t catalog .
```
One-step, build and test on a cluster:
```bash
make build-image push-image deploy
```